About the Event

Every writer’s process is different. Who says you have to compose music on a piano or read sheet music to be musical? Yve Blake is a composer who doesn't play a single musical instrument, and can't read a note of music - and yet she wrote the book, music and lyrics to an AWGIE award-winning musical. So, no matter your level of musical 'ability', Yve will take you through her methods of how to get started writing a musical on your own terms, and how to keep going!

Getting started can be the hardest part of the writing process, and Yve has a particular knack and passion for empowering young artists to find their voice. Yve will cover songwriting and composition for people who don’t play an instrument, how to generate ideas and material, and how to take your writing to that next stage of development once the first draft is done. The session is practical, fun and suitable for performers, theatremakers and writers of all levels; if musicals are your jam and you want to know how to write one, this workshops for you.
